- The distance between Te Kauwhata Maf, New Zealand and Hamilton, On, Canada is approximately 13,834 km or 8,597 mi.
- To reach Te Kauwhata Maf in this distance one would set out from Hamilton, On bearing 248.5°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Te Kauwhata Maf bearing 238.7° or WSW .
- Te Kauwhata Maf has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Hamilton, On has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Te Kauwhata Maf is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ome whereas Hamilton, On is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 6.7 °C (12.1°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 17.3 °C (31.1°F) less in Te Kauwhata Maf.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 255 mm (10 in) more which is equivalent to 255 l/m² (6.26 US gal/ft²) or 2,550,000 l/ha (272,612 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 5.1° higher in Te Kauwhata Maf than in Hamilton, On.
